In the warm evening of July 11, 2011, in Memphis, Tennessee, the life of 17-year-old Jacob Manuel, a Black male, was tragically cut short. Just after 8:00 p.m., shots rang out in the 1600 block of Ash Street. When police arrived, they found Jacob with a gunshot wound to his head. He was rushed to the hospital but succumbed to his injuries shortly after. At the time of his death, Jacob had recently graduated from Douglass High School.
